Energizer Holdings, Inc. (ENR) has embarked on a strategic debt refinancing initiative that underscores its commitment to optimizing capital structure and enhancing long-term financial resilience. By issuing $400 million in 6.00% Senior Notes due 2033 and augmenting its Term Loan with an additional $100 million maturing in 2032, the company aims to extend its debt maturity profile while reducing cash interest expenses[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1]. These actions, part of a broader refinancing strategy, reflect a calculated effort to align its liabilities with sustainable growth objectives and mitigate refinancing risks in a volatile interest rate environment[Why Is Energizer (ENR) Down 5.2% Since Last Earnings Report][2].

Credit Impact: Stability Amid Leverage Reduction

The refinancing activities have drawn attention from credit rating agencies, with Moody'sMCO-- assigning a Ba1 rating to Energizer's new revolver and affirming a stable outlook[Energizer Holdings, Inc. -- Moody's assigns Ba1 rating to ...][3]. This rating reflects Moody's expectation that the company's debt-to-EBITDA ratio will decline from 6.0x to approximately 5.3x over the next 12–18 months, a material improvement that signals enhanced creditworthiness[Energizer Holdings, Inc. -- Moody's assigns Ba1 rating to ...][3]. The reduction in leverage is primarily driven by the redemption of higher-cost 6.50% Senior Notes due 2027, which carry a 50 basis point premium over the newly issued 2033 notes[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1]. By replacing short-term obligations with longer-dated, lower-cost debt, EnergizerENR-- is effectively de-risking its balance sheet and extending its liquidity runway.

However, Moody's cautionary note remains relevant: if Energizer's leverage ratio exceeds 5.5x or if the company pursues debt-financed acquisitions, the ratings could face downward pressure[Energizer Holdings, Inc. -- Moody's assigns Ba1 rating to ...][3]. This underscores the importance of disciplined capital allocation and adherence to its stated financial metrics.

Capital Structure Optimization: Balancing Cost and Maturity

Energizer's refinancing strategy exemplifies a nuanced approach to capital structure management. The $400 million senior notes offering, upsized from an initial $300 million target, demonstrates strong investor demand for the company's debt instruments[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1]. By securing fixed-rate financing at 6.00%, Energizer locks in favorable terms amid potential future rate hikes, thereby insulating itself from near-term volatility in borrowing costs. Simultaneously, the $100 million Term Loan add-on, priced at SOFR plus 200 basis points, provides flexibility while maintaining leverage neutrality[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1].

The net proceeds from these transactions will be used to redeem the 6.50% Senior Notes due 2027, repay amounts on the Revolving Credit Facility, and fund general corporate purposes[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1]. This restructuring not only eliminates a near-term refinancing obligation but also reduces annual interest expenses by approximately $2 million ($400M × (6.50% – 6.00%))[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1]. Over the next five years, Energizer's debt maturity profile will shift from a concentration of short-term liabilities to a more balanced distribution, with key maturities in 2032 and 2033[ENERGIZER HOLDINGS, INC. Announces Debt Refinancing Activity, Extending Maturity Profile][1].

Financial Performance and Shareholder Returns

Energizer's recent financial results further validate the rationale for its refinancing efforts. In Q3 2025, the company reported adjusted earnings of $1.13 per share, exceeding the Zacks Consensus Estimate, and achieved a 43% year-over-year increase in net income[Why Is Energizer (ENR) Down 5.2% Since Last Earnings Report][2]. These metrics, coupled with a 3.4% year-over-year rise in net sales to $725.3 million, highlight operational strength and margin expansion driven by cost-saving initiatives like Project Momentum[Why Is Energizer (ENR) Down 5.2% Since Last Earnings Report][2].

Shareholder returns have also remained a priority, with Energizer repurchasing 2.8 million shares for $62.6 million and returning $84 million to shareholders through dividends and buybacks[Why Is Energizer (ENR) Down 5.2% Since Last Earnings Report][2]. Such actions, combined with debt reduction, signal a balanced approach to capital deployment that prioritizes both financial discipline and long-term value creation.

Risks and Market Dynamics

Despite these positives, Energizer's stock has declined 5.2% since its last earnings report, underperforming the broader market[Why Is Energizer (ENR) Down 5.2% Since Last Earnings Report][2]. This dip may reflect investor concerns about macroeconomic headwinds, such as inflationary pressures or shifting consumer demand for battery-powered products. Additionally, while the company's leverage reduction is commendable, its Ba1 credit rating remains below investment-grade thresholds, necessitating continued vigilance in managing debt levels[Energizer Holdings, Inc. -- Moody's assigns Ba1 rating to ...][3].
